Ethanol production starts once various organic ingredients such as fruits, vegetables or grains are crushed and mixed with water. These ingredients depend on the final alcoholic drink that is required to be produced. For example, producing wine would require grapes; beer would require barley or rice, while whiskey would require wheat, barley or corn, and so on. While milder alcohols such as beer and wine would require various processes including fermentation to produce them, stronger alcohols such as whiskey and vodka would also require the distillation process to turn the ethanol into stronger alcohol.
You could also manufacture bio ethanol to fuel your car by using variations in the production process. Bioethanol production requires fermenting and distilling of corn along with water and the resultant liquid can be used as a biofuel to propel your car at a very cost-effective rate. However, making ethanol requires the use of hardy yeast usually from the family of the saccharomyces cerevisiae yeast, which ferments the sugars in the mixture of water with the other key ingredients and turns it into ethanol.
If you plan to use ordinary wine yeast, whisky yeast or vodka yeast then you might not get strong ethanol and your yeast would also die if the yeast temperature crosses over 27 degrees Celsius. If you plan to produce strong alcohols such as whisky or brandy then you will need to set up a matching whisky distillery or brandy distillery on a commercial or domestic scale based on your requirements. Your distilling unit will need a heat source to boil the fermented ethanol before condensing the vapors back into liquid form to considerably increase the strength of your ethanol.
